Job Description - Wellness Centre Transportation Driver and Coordinator

The Position

Under the general supervision of the Wellness Centre Manager, the Transportation Driver/Coordinator is a conscientious driver who can safely and efficiently transport and supervise passengers, maintain the bus and associated records, and coordinate service delivery with all approved families. 

 

The Candidate

  • Safely drive the bus.
  • Supervise the loading and unloading of passengers according to safety protocols and passenger health needs as directed.
  • Communicate professionally with students, families, staff and others; provide general information and respond to inquiries of all passengers and their families.
  • Design and drive regular bus routes – communicating scheduling with families and service interruption and/or changes.
  • Supervise children and youth as necessary and/or assist elders on some events/outings.
  • Perform minor first aid and complete required forms as needed.
  • Maintain a record of concerns/incidents regarding any problems encountered during the transportation of passengers and notify the Supervisor immediately when safe to do so.
  • Ensure all licenses are kept valid and current, including CPR/First Aid certificates.
  • Report any anticipated late delivery or pickup of passengers to the Supervisor or designate as soon as possible, directly informing the passenger or parent of changes wherever possible.
  • Ensure only passengers who have been approved are transported to and from their destinations.
  • Observe all the road rules, including speed limits and safety regulations.
  • Always conduct oneself courteously and professionally.
  • Maintain a flexible schedule to ensure availability for occasional deliveries on behalf of departments and/or extra runs, and/or special activities (e.g., field trips/outings) outside normal working hours.
  • Collaborate with the Supervisor to explore the additional transportation needs of families and how the Nation can respond to these needs.
  • Support policy development and advocacy work of the department as appropriate.
  • Perform daily pre- and post-van and/or bus trip safety inspections and report any necessary repairs or concerns.
  • Ensure Nation vehicles are fueled and ready for service.
  • Ensure cleanliness of Nation vehicles: cleaning and sanitizing as needed after trips; ensuring an adequate supply of face masks and hand sanitizer is available as required.
  • Ensure that all equipment regarding the vehicle is maintained according to the manufacturer’s guidelines and safety regulations. Plan and schedule vehicle maintenance and inspections.
  • Coordinate the repairs of vehicles with Nation departments and external providers as required.
  • Follow all COVID protocols and safety requirements as directed.
  • Follow the Motor Vehicle Act and Regulations.
  • Perform all other tasks within the scope of the position and as assigned.

 

Qualifications, Skills and Abilities

  • Minimum Grade 10 education; High School Diploma or equivalent desirable. 
  • Minimum of five (5) years of driving experience.
  • Knowledge of the community and city is required.
  • Respect for, sensitivity towards, knowledge, and understanding of shíshálh culture and traditions.
  • Be able to lift 40 lbs. when necessary.
  • Minimum Class 4 license with a clear driver's abstract throughout employment.
  • Clear Vulnerable Sector Check.
  • CPR and First Aid Certificate.
  • Pre-employment physical completed by a family physician or Nurse Practitioner.
  • Must be able to adhere to the Medical Transportation Policy.
